| Canonical Smiles | CC(C1=NC2=CC=CC=C2N1)N.Cl |
|---|---|
| IUPAC Name | (1R)-1-(1H-benzimidazol-2-yl)ethanamine;hydrochloride |
| InChIKey | HFHWHWCRHSKBOZ-FYZOBXCZSA-N |
| INCHI | 1S/C9H11N3.ClH/c1-6(10)9-11-7-4-2-3-5-8(7)12-9;/h2-6H,10H2,1H3,(H,11,12);1H/t6-;/m1./s1 |
| Isomeric SMILES | C[C@H](C1=NC2=CC=CC=C2N1)N.Cl |
| PubChem CID | 54579840 |
| Molecular Weight | 197.66 |

| Kingdom | Organic compounds |
|---|---|
| Superclass | Organoheterocyclic compounds |
| Class | Benzimidazoles |
| Subclass | Not available |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Benzimidazoles |
| Alternative Parents | Aralkylamines Benzenoids Imidazoles Heteroaromatic compounds Azacyclic compounds Organopnictogen compounds Monoalkylamines Hydrochlorides Hydrocarbon derivatives |
| Molecular Framework | Aromatic heteropolycyclic compounds |
| Substituents | Benzimidazole - Aralkylamine - Benzenoid - Azole - Imidazole - Heteroaromatic compound - Azacycle - Hydrocarbon derivative - Organopnictogen compound - Primary amine - Organonitrogen compound - Primary aliphatic amine - Organic nitrogen compound - Hydrochloride - Amine - Aromatic heteropolycyclic compound |
| Description | This compound belongs to the class of organic compounds known as benzimidazoles. These are organic compounds containing a benzene ring fused to an imidazole ring (five member ring containing a nitrogen atom, 4 carbon atoms, and two double bonds). |
